Description

This 64" x 84" white cotton quilt is embroidered with yellow and black thread. It includes 35 circles divided into 16 triangles, half yellow, half black. Twenty-three of the circles contain embroidered autographs of the members of the Women's Circle of Ripon's St. Peter's church and their family members. Some circles are not embroidered with names but have a letter of the alphabet in their center. One circle has the date 1916 which is when the quilt was made as a fundraiser. The following names with their titles are among the names on the quilt: Mrs. George C. Graf, President, Parochial Branch; Miss Anna Gillette, Secretary, Parochial Branch; Mrs. Edgar C. Barnes, Treasurer. The quilt is intact but the fabric is yellowed and some of the black embroidery has stained or run on the white fabric. All the quilting is hand sewn. A complete list of names with diagram is kept in Donor's File for exhibit purposes. Quilt is stored with Quilt Collection at Pickard. House. 2016 Note: Says on quilt "Ladies Society". 2017 Note: A1217: Added to National Quilt Index 2/4/2017 by WI Museum of Quilts & Fiber Arts, Cedarburg, WI.
